I agree that a connection has reference semantics and that connection::connected() therefore returns information about the thing being referenced (as opposed to the handle itself). According the logic above, however, doesn't the fact that connection::block() is non-const seem inconsistent? In other words, it would seem that connection::disconnect() and connection::block() should both be either const or non-const for consistency.
